Output 62ec15b85c444420b6dd81a26411bbf1e248115830a3db2667ac02e909713510:0

value
834947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be1bd6fad6883a87766f7c27ea7380c75fcf9eea OP_EQUAL
address
3K2DfLEAUwwmuYxJyStjBn4nzzXMn5hsWs
transaction
62ec15b85c444420b6dd81a26411bbf1e248115830a3db2667ac02e909713510
spent
true